قَالَ لَهُ مُحَمَّدُ بْنُ عَبْدِ اللَّهِ الْقُمِّيُّ إِنَّ لَنَا ضِيَاعاً فِيهَا بُيُوتُ النِّيرَانِ تُهْدِي إِلَيْهَا الْمَجُوسُ الْبَقَرَ وَ الْغَنَمَ وَ الدَّرَاهِمَ فَهَلْ لِأَرْبَابِ الْقُرَى أَنْ يَأْخُذُوا ذَلِكَ وَ لِبُيُوتِ نِيرَانِهِمْ قُوَّامٌ يَقُومُونَ  عَلَيْهَا قَالَ لِيَأْخُذْهُ صَاحِبُ الْقُرَى لَيْسَ بِهِ بَأْسٌ .


Translation

Sahl Bin Ziyad, from Ahmad Bin Muhammad, from Abdullah Bin Al Mugheira, (It has been narrated) from Abu Al-Hassan<sup>asws</sup>, said: ‘Muhammad Bin Abdullah Al-Qummy said to him<sup>asws</sup>, ‘We have an estate wherein are house of fire-worship, the Magians tend to gift to it the cows, and the sheep and the Dirhams. So is it Permissible for the lords of the town that they should be taking that, and for the houses of the fire-worship there are people who are standing (in charge) over it?’ He<sup>asws</sup> said: ‘Let the masters of the town take it. There is no problem with it’.
